Ray Tracing and Real-Time Rendering
Ray tracing technology has advanced considerably, enabling instantaneous image generation that produces lifelike illumination and reflections. Next-generation cards incorporate dedicated ray-tracing cores that handle complex light calculations substantially faster than earlier generations. This development enables developers to build immersive environments with precise shadow rendering, reflections, and global illumination effects. The enhanced efficiency decreases the processing load, allowing ray tracing at smooth frame rates without necessitating aggressive compromises on visual settings or resolution.
The evolution of ray-tracing capabilities represents a core shift in how games display three-dimensional worlds. By simulating light properties more accurately, developers can create environments that respond dynamically to dynamic lighting conditions. This technology goes further than simple reflections, including ambient occlusion, subsurface scattering, and sophisticated lighting effects. Gamers will see substantially improved visual realism, especially in exterior settings and scenes showcasing water, glass, and metallic surfaces that gain from accurate light simulation.
DLSS and Scaling Technologies
Deep Learning Super Sampling (DLSS) and rival upscaling technologies constitute revolutionary approaches to efficiency improvement. These advanced neural networks render games at reduced pixel counts before expanding to the desired output resolution using AI-driven processing. The method preserves outstanding image fidelity whilst achieving substantial performance gains. Latest-generation versions provide various quality settings, letting users reconcile speed with image quality based on their needs and system specifications.
Upscaling technology has developed substantially, with machine learning models trained to preserve fine details convincingly. Modern implementations utilise temporal information, examining sequential frames to deliver enhanced output compared to standard upscaling approaches. This approach allows players to reach elevated frame rates without compromising image clarity, making elevated refresh-rate gaming accessible across various monitor specifications. The technology proves particularly valuable for resource-heavy titles where preserving 144Hz or higher performance would otherwise require substantial visual compromises.
